On Nov. 28, WikiLeaks released a massive cache of secret diplomatic cables divulging private conversations between world leaders. TIME looks at other famous leaks that were often as damning as they were sensational
It's been quite a year for whistleblowing website Wikileaks. Its latest info dump, a treasure trove of diplomatic cables spanning the world, has caused an international uproar. U.S. politicians like Hillary Clinton and New York Congressman Peter King (pictured) called the leak a threat to global security, with King going so far as calling for Wikileaks founder Julian Assange to be prosecuted under the Espionage Act and for his site to be deemed a foreign terrorist organization.
